Personal data Freerkje van Maassen 


Household of Freerkje van Maassen

She is married to Douwe Postma.

They got married on May 12, 1883 at Kollumerland c.a., Friesland, Nederland, she was 20 years old.Source 3


Child(ren):

  1. Stijntje Postma  1887-1924
  2. Eelse Postma  1890-1971
  3. Tjibbe Postma  1893-1976
